Description
This machine is designed to cool the water and to keep it circulating around the tanks which are processing hot substances and need to be cooled quickly.
The cool water absorbs the heat from the hot substances, returning to the machine to be cooled again. Thus, succeeding in pasteurizing mixtures for ice cream, which need an abrupt temperature drop; as well as accomplishing many other processes in the food industry and other industries. (For example, in the mechanical industry, the water refrigeration unit is used to cool plastic parts immediately after they are injected into the moulding.)
